The Lubrański Academy was active in Poznań during the years 1518/1519-1780, initially as an independent institution and in the 17th and 18th c. as a branch-school of the Cracow Academy. If the coat of arms of the Lubranscianum existed already in the 16th c., one of its elements could have been Godzięba (pine tree) – the charge from the arms of bishop Jan Lubrański, the founder of the Academy.
